Broken Key Fobs

The last thing anyone wants to see while trying to start their car is an unusable key fob. Even if a key fob has been damaged beyond repair, it is often possible to make it work again.

If you have a device that's not responding to the buttons first thing to do is determine if the batteries are dead. This is the easiest thing to fix, and it's usually easy enough to fix at home. You'll need to remove the case of your key fob (you can find directions on the internet) and take note of the type of battery it's using and the way it is placed inside the case. Then, you can insert the correct type of battery and close the case. If you have a remote-tester you can use, then test the key fob to see whether it's functioning.

There's also a chance that something has occurred to the circuit board in your fob that's causing it not to work properly. It is more difficult to pinpoint and fix this problem, but it may be as simple as pouring water on the fob. This circuit board is responsible for transferring electrical signals. It then responds to the button you press.

This board is also likely to become dirty over time and that's why it's important to clean it often. There are a few methods to clean it depending on the material your key fob is composed of. You can either disassemble it to clean the circuit board with a cleaning solution or use some rubbing alcohol on the contacts. Be cautious and only do this in safe areas.

The final option could be that you just require a new fob. You can do it yourself, but you'll require a few tools. You will need to be capable of prying the case, which may require a screwdriver, or some force. You'll need to purchase a new key fob case. You can usually find a good deal online.

Transponder Chip Issues

Transponder chips may malfunction in key fobs. The chips communicate with the vehicle every time you insert the key into the ignition. This adds an extra layer to security and prevents hot-wiring. Your car won't start if the signal is not received. If this is the situation you'll need remove your current keyfob.

The key fob's battery could be dead too. These key fobs can be quite sturdy, but their tiny lithium battery does go bad over time. It is simple to replace the battery in your Toyota Key Fob. The trick is to take off the metal key and make use of a screwdriver or coin to open the notch at the back of the encasing and then pull upwards on the circuit board to reach the battery.

In addition to battery issues there are other common reasons that the transponder chip might fail. One of these is dropping the key fob on a study surface or submerging it in water. This could cause a shorting of the chip, making it inaccessible.
